Bola is a small village of 3355 hectares in Barmer Tehsil in Barmer district in the State of Rajasthan, India.[2] The village is administrated by a sarpanch who is elected representative of the village by the local elections. Bola depends on BARMER, the nearest town for all major economic activities.[3] The village has government-provided water facilities that include One tap, One Well supply, One tank, One tubewell, and One handpump. The villagers also acquire water from some of the natural water sources - Two rivers, Two canals and Two springs. Bola is also surrounded by Two lakes. The population of the village depends on the source of drinking water during summer on Well. Bola's pin code is 344001[4], and village code is 02211700. The area of Bola is segregated as 2714.06 hectares unirrigated, remaining 641.39 hectare area not available for cultivation.

Bola has One post office (Bola B.O) and One public telephone. The village is connected with a single bus service. Bola has Two banks and Two credit societies for the regulation of economic activity. The village is also equipped with Two recreational centers.

The village has an uninterrupted 24 hours electric supply from a power grid.

Demographics

Bola is a census village in the district of Barmer, Rajasthan. The village has a total population of 1949 and has total administration over 332 houses which are connected to supplies basic amenities like water and sewerage.

  • Bola has 369 children, 198 boys and 171 girls.
  • Scheduled caste counts for 100 (5.13%) males constitute 44 (2.26%) of the population and females 56 (2.87%).
  • Scheduled tribe counts for 382 (19.60%) males constitute 210 (10.77%) of the population and females 172 (8.83%).

Educational institutions

As per the census 2011 report, 826 people are literate in Bola out of which 556 are males and 270 are females.

Bola has the following educational facilities:

  • 1 Education facility
  • 3 Primary schools
  • 1 Upper primary school
  • 3 Colleges in the nearby range
  • 1 Adult literacy center

Employment

According to a census 2011 report, 1178 people of the total population are employed. The workforce is 601 male, 577 female with 535 (45.42%) of all workers being employed full-time, this includes 367 males and 168 females. 335 males and 166 females are considered as the main cultivators with the help of 1 male. 643 people are reported to work for a marginal period of time in the year.

They depend on the agricultural markets (Mandi) of the nearby towns of Barmer to sell agricultural produce and make their living.
